Product Introduction


The Serpentine Tube is manufactured using high quality carbon steel, stainless steel, or alloy steel to ensure excellent strength and resistance to high temperature and pressure. Its unique coiled structure increases the heat transfer surface area, improving thermal efficiency and optimizing fluid flow. Advanced bending and welding technologies ensure precise shaping and consistent quality. This Serpentine Tube is designed for continuous operation, delivering stable performance in harsh industrial environments.

 

Applications


The Serpentine Tube is widely used in heat exchangers, boilers, condensers, and industrial heating systems. It is suitable for industries such as power generation, petrochemical processing, food production, and manufacturing. The Serpentine Tube plays a key role in transferring heat efficiently between fluids, ensuring stable process performance. Its versatility makes it suitable for a wide range of global industrial applications.

Advantages


The Serpentine Tube provides excellent heat transfer efficiency due to its extended surface area and optimized flow path, ensuring maximum thermal performance. This helps reduce energy consumption and improve system efficiency.

Another key advantage of the Serpentine Tube is its durability. Constructed from high quality materials, it offers strong resistance to high temperature, pressure, and corrosion, ensuring reliable operation in harsh environments.

Additionally, the Serpentine Tube features a compact and flexible design that allows easy installation and integration into various systems. Its long service life and low maintenance requirements reduce operational costs.
